Overview of Contract Authoring Tools Market

The Contract Authoring Tools market encompasses software solutions designed to facilitate the creation, editing, and management of legal and business contracts. These tools automate the drafting process, ensure compliance with legal standards, and enable version control and collaboration among stakeholders. Core products include contract lifecycle management (CLM) platforms, document automation software, and AI-powered drafting assistants.

Key end-use industries span legal services, corporate legal departments, procurement, real estate, and financial services. These tools are vital in streamlining contractual workflows, reducing manual errors, and accelerating deal closures. Their importance in the global economy is underscored by the increasing complexity of legal agreements and the demand for digital transformation, which enhances operational efficiency, reduces costs, and mitigates contractual risks across sectors.

Contract Authoring Tools Market Segmentation Analysis

By Type, the market segments into standalone contract drafting software, integrated CLM platforms, and AI-powered drafting assistants. The fastest-growing segment is AI-powered tools, driven by advancements in natural language processing and machine learning, which enhance drafting efficiency and accuracy.

By Application, key sectors include legal services, corporate legal departments, procurement, real estate, and financial services. The legal and corporate sectors are expected to dominate, with increasing demand for automation and compliance management. Geographically, North America and Europe currently lead, but APAC is rapidly catching up due to expanding digital initiatives and regulatory reforms.

Emerging markets in Asia-Pacific and the Middle East are poised for the highest growth rates, driven by enterprise expansion and government support for digital transformation. The contract automation segment is projected to witness the most significant growth, reflecting technological innovation and industry demand for streamlined workflows.
